Overview of Alarms
NCK alarms
22012
Channel %1 block %2 leading spindle %3 is in simulation.
Parameters:
%1 = Channel number
%2 = Block number, label
%3 = Leading spindle number
Definitions:
When coupling, no synchronism can be achieved if the lead spindle/axis is in simulation mode and the
following spindle/axis is not.
Reaction:
Alarm display.
Remedy:
Set the following spindle/axis to simulation mode, or do not simulate the lead spindle/axis
($MA_CTRLOUT_TYPE). If the differing settings have been selected on purpose, the alarm can be
suppressed with the machine data 11410 SUPPRESS_ALARM_MASK Bit21 = 1.
Program
Clear alarm with the Delete key or NC START.
Continuation:
22013
Channel %1 block %2 dependent spindle %3 is in simulation.
Parameters:
%1 = Channel number
%2 = Block number, label
%3 = Number of following spindle
Definitions:
When coupling, no synchronism can be achieved if the following spindle/axis is in simulation mode
and the lead spindle/axis is not.
Reaction:
Alarm display.
Remedy:
Set the lead spindle/axis to simulation mode, or do not simulate the following spindle/axis
($MA_CTRLOUT_TYPE). If the differing settings have been selected on purpose, the alarm can be
suppressed with the machine data 11410 SUPPRESS_ALARM_MASK Bit21 = 1.
Program
Clear alarm with the Delete key or NC START.
Continuation:
22014
Channel %1 block %2. The dynamics of leading spindle %3 and
dependent spindle %4 is too variably
Parameters:
%1 = Channel number
%2 = Block number, label
%3 = Leading spindle number
%4 = Number of following spindle
Definitions:
If the spindles / axes differ strongly in their dynamic behavior during coupling, synchronism cannot be
achieved. The dynamics are dependent on many settings: default feedforward control, parameter
block data, first of all the servo gain factor, symmetrizing time, etc., feedforward control mode and
feedforward setting parameter, FIPO mode, jerk filter and dynamic filter settings, DSC on/off. Among
these are the following machine data: MA_FFW_MODE, MA_VELO_FFW_WEIGHT,
MA_FIPO_TYPE, VEL_FFW_TIME, MA_EQUIV_SPEEDCTRL_TIME, MA_POSCTRL_GAIN,
AX_JERK_TIME, STIFFNESS_DELAY_TIME, PROFIBUS_ACTVAL_LEAD_TIME,
PROFIBUS_OUTVAL_DELAY_TIME, CTRLOUT_LEAD_TIME
Reaction:
Alarm display.
Remedy:
Use spindles/axes with the same dynamics. If the differing settings have been selected on purpose,
the alarm can be suppressed with the machine data 11410 SUPPRESS_ALARM_MASK Bit21 = 1.
Program
Clear alarm with the Delete key or NC START.
Continuation:
